How long do Lego light bricks last?

Lego light bricks are made with long lasting LEDs that will not overheat or burn out. With proper care, your Lego light brick should last for years!

Does LEGO degrade?

LEGO bricks are made from ABS plastic, which is a durable material that does not degrade easily. However, if LEGO bricks are exposed to sunlight or high temperatures for extended periods of time, they may become brittle and break more easily.

You are what you eat. This statement stands correct because our bodies respond to whatever we feed them. A simple example is obesity because of junk food. Food has the power to either destroy or heal your body. Heal your body through food. Food can heal your body of many diseases. The doctors recommend correcting all the deficiencies through food. Can we cure hormonal imbalance? Hormonal imbalance is when our hormones can be either low or high. The problem arises when they start affecting our lives. The most commonly affected hormone in women is estrogen. We can pick this up on a female hormone test. Estrogen disbalance can occur naturally or pathologically. However, some foods might save you from having to use medicines. Phytoestrogens Phytoestrogens are just like estrogens, but these originate from plants. Therefore, we also call them "dietary estrogens." These are a sight for sore eyes for bodies that are low on estrogens. However, they can provide us with additional benefits. All the foods with phytoestrogens can boost your estrogen levels. Natural foods which increase estrogens Here is a list of all the foods which can directly elevate your estrogens levels. Ground flaxseeds Ground flaxseeds are a reservoir of phytoestrogens. You can buy these easily from any grocery store. Nevertheless, it would be best if you did not consume them as they are. Humans are unable to digest the outer coat. Therefore, it is best to blend it into powder form. Use it by adding some quantity to your oatmeal, pancake batter, milkshakes, and a protein shake. Dark chocolate Dark chocolate can boost estrogen to some extent. It is known to increase focus and release endorphins. In addition, the flavonoids present in chocolate can work similarly to estrogens. Wheat bran The lignan content in the wheat bran is a phytoestrogen. Bran is also famous for its high fibre content. Studies prove that bran increases estrogens by its high fibre content and with lignan, to some extent. Tofu The secret ingredient in tofu is isoflavones, another phytoestrogen. It is a rich source of dietary estrogens. Peaches Peaches are rich in lignan. In addition to many vitamins and minerals, it can increase your estrogen levels. Garlic Garlic can increase some levels of estrogens. However, people avoid them due to their pungent odour. Other foods that boost estrogen levels are dry fruits, some vegetables, soya beans, sesame seeds, etc. The key is to eat these in moderation. Too many phytoestrogens might be harmful to your body. Vitamins that increase estrogens Vitamin D and E provide some estrogen-related benefits. However, they are not a substitute for estrogen; instead, their functions can compensate for it. For example, vitamin D can increase bone density and protect against osteoporosis. It also provides some heart disease benefits. Both these conditions are direct side effects of low estrogens. Low estrogens on a female hormone test is a sign of concern. It is better to compensate for it with food than medications.
